I just disagree with the first one about "it's only to explain problem statements or something" as per cf rules you can:
"Permitted AI Use:

  • Translation of Problem Statements: You may use AI-based systems to translate problem statements, but you must ensure that the system does not interpret or summarize the statement. Only direct translations are allowed."
